{"id":367423,"date":"2025-11-09T18:23:12","date_gmt":"2025-11-09T18:23:12","guid":{"rendered":"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/us\/367423\/"},"modified":"2025-11-09T18:23:12","modified_gmt":"2025-11-09T18:23:12","slug":"pushing-yelling-from-conservative-leadership-sealed-the-deal-on-defection-dentremont","status":"publish","type":"post","link":"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/us\/367423\/","title":{"rendered":"Pushing, yelling from Conservative leadership \u2018sealed the deal\u2019 on defection: d\u2019Entremont"},"content":{"rendered":"<p><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/www.cbc.ca\/a\/assets\/texttospeech.svg\" alt=\"Text to Speech Icon\" width=\"44\" height=\"44\"\/><\/p>\n<p>Listen to this article<\/p>\n<p>Estimated 4 minutes<\/p>\n<p>The audio version of this article is generated by text-to-speech, a technology based on artificial intelligence.<\/p>\n<p>Nova Scotia MP Chris d\u2019Entremont says pushing and yelling from Conservative Party leadership &#8220;sealed the deal&#8221; on his choice to <a href=\"https:\/\/www.cbc.ca\/news\/politics\/chris-dentremont-liberals-poilievre-9.6967559\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">cross the floor<\/a> of the House of Commons to the Liberals this week.<\/p>\n<p>After d\u2019Entremont\u2019s musings over a possible defection were reported by <a href=\"https:\/\/www.politico.com\/news\/2025\/11\/04\/dentremont-considering-canada-liberal-government-00635851\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Politico<\/a> on Tuesday, the MP says Conservative House leader Andrew Scheer and party whip Chris Warkentin \u201cbarged\u201d into his office, pushed his assistant aside and yelled at him about \u201chow much of a snake\u201d he was.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It really pushed me to a point where it\u2019s like, &#8216;OK, I guess my decision is made for sure now,&#8217;\u201d he said in an interview on CBC&#8217;s Rosemary Barton Live that aired Sunday morning.<\/p>\n<p>Describing the \u201cnegativity\u201d and \u201cbeating up on someone else\u201d coming from Conservative leadership, d\u2019Entremont said, \u201ca lot of times I felt it was part of a frat house rather than a serious political party.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p>The Conservative Party has denied d&#8217;Entremont&#8217;s allegations.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Conservatives deny violence<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>&#8220;Chris d\u2019Entremont, who established himself a liar after wilfully deceiving his voters, friends and colleagues because he was upset he didn\u2019t get his coveted deputy speaker role, is now spinning more lies after crossing the floor. He will fit in perfectly in the Liberal caucus,&#8221; a spokesperson for the Office of the Leader of the Official Opposition said in a statement to CBC News.<\/p>\n<p>D&#8217;Entremont told Rosemary Barton Live guest host Catherine Cullen that he&#8217;s moved on from not getting the Speaker job and that the notion of floor crossing had been on his mind \u201cfor a long time, basically from the election.\u201d<\/p>\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" loading=\"lazy\" alt=\"Prime Minister Mark Carney walks with MP Chris d'Entremont, who crossed the floor from Conservative caucus to join the Liberals\"   src=\"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/us\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/11\/1762712591_684_default.jpg\" style=\"aspect-ratio:1.5052698818268924\" data-cy=\"image-img\"\/>Prime Minister Mark Carney, left, walks with MP Chris d&#8217;Entremont, who crossed the floor from the Conservative caucus to join the Liberals, on Parliament Hill in Ottawa on Wednesday. (Justin Tang\/The Canadian Press)<\/p>\n<p>When asked if the Liberals suggested more opportunity, such as a cabinet spot, in exchange for his defection, d\u2019Entremont said, \u201cNo, absolutely not.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p>He said he heard from several longtime supporters during the election campaign that they would not support him anymore because of the leadership style of the Conservative Party.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>It got to a point, d\u2019Entremont said, where he had to distance his re-election campaign from Conservative Leader Pierre Poilievre. \u201cWe tried to stay away from pictures of the leader.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p>Growing discontent from his constituents, plus a meeting with Prime Minister Mark Carney on Tuesday, made his next moves clearer, he said \u2014 though he notes that he did not intend for the story to come out through a \u201cpassing comment\u201d he made to Politico on the release day of the federal budget.<\/p>\n<p>A second shot to the Conservatives<\/p>\n<p>D\u2019Entremont\u2019s floor crossing has sparked questions about chaos and discontent in the Conservative caucus \u2014 which were only amplified when Edmonton Riverbend MP Matt Jeneroux announced his intentions to resign from politics just two days later.<\/p>\n<p>According to a Liberal source, Jeneroux also met with Carney earlier this week.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p><strong>WATCH | Jeneroux&#8217;s exit is another blow to Poilievre:<\/strong><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/us\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/11\/1762712592_543_default.jpg\"  alt=\"\" class=\"thumbnail\" loading=\"lazy\"\/><\/p>\n<p class=\"video-item-title\">Conservative MP Matt Jeneroux resigns<\/p>\n<p>Matt Jeneroux, the MP for the Alberta riding of Edmonton Riverbend, announced his resignation from the House of Commons on Thursday.<\/p>\n<p>Sources tell CBC News that former Conservative campaign manager Jenni Byrne,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.cbc.ca\/news\/politics\/poilievre-byrne-conservative-caucus-1.7540215\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">who has faced criticism<\/a> for &#8220;toxic and angry&#8221; behaviour, has been involved in the party&#8217;s efforts to quash any further floor crossings.<\/p>\n<p>In a statement following his resignation, Jeneroux said he was not coerced by the Conservatives to resign.<\/p>\n<p>Asked whether he thought Jeneroux was intending to cross the floor prior to his resignation, d\u2019Entremont said, \u201cI\u2019ll let him tell his story.\u201d\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Will more Conservatives defect?<\/p>\n<p>The Nova Scotia MP did say he believed \u201cthree or four\u201d other Conservative caucus members were considering crossing the floor when he was deliberating over his decision to leave.<\/p>\n<p>D\u2019Entremont said Conservative MPs had some opportunities to speak to Poilievre over the summer to address any concerns over tone and leadership style.<\/p>\n<p>The MP said he believed that Poilievre, through those conversations, would be changing his leadership style, but then when the fall session began, \u201cit didn\u2019t really seem anything was changing.\u201d\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>While d\u2019Entremont said he is happy with the decision he\u2019s made, he hasn\u2019t committed to running as a Liberal in the next election \u2014 or running at all, for that matter.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I\u2019m not sure at this point,\u201d he said. \u201cI&#8217;m 56, I need to spend some time at home maybe.
